> > > The problem is that the secondary CPU doesn't hold the rwsem when it
> > > calls __static_key_slow_inc() in its boot path. It cannot take the
> > > rwsem, since the primaary CPU holds this for the duration of onlining
> > > the secondary CPU.
>
> Looking deeper into that:
>
> secondary_start_kernel()
> check_local_cpu_capabilities()
> update_cpu_errata_workarounds()
> update_cpu_capabilities()
> static_key_enable()
> __static_key_slow_inc()
> jump_label_lock()
> mutex_lock(&jump_label_mutex);
>
> How is that supposed to work?
>
> That call path is the low level CPU bringup, running in the context of the
> idle task of that CPU with interrupts and preemption disabled. Taking a
> mutex in that context, even if in that case the mutex is uncontended, is a
> NONO.
Urgh; good point. Thanks for taking a look.
I think I can solve both issues by deferring poking the keys, so I'll
give that a go.
As an aside, do we have anything that should detect the broken mutex
usage? I've been testing kernels with LOCKDEP, PROVE_LOCKING,
DEBUG_ATOMIC_SLEEP, and friends, and nothing has complained so far.
